blackcrow Posted July 23, 2010 Share Posted July 23, 2010 Re: NRL Round 20 Eels -13.5 @ 3.00 centrebet Looks like the Eels may be making another run for the semi finals as their form over the last two games has been very good. They overcame a 22 point deficit to beat the Panthers last week with Hayne in great form, but the forward pack has started to make in roads into the opposition's defensive line. Obviously the form of Hayne has been a stand out and like him to dominate the Bulldogs here who look outclassed. The Eels match up well in the backs and forwards against the Bulldogs who pretty much are out of the running for a top 8 spot. Also with the Eels having won 7of their past 8 games against the Bulldogs, and with all seven of those wins at ANZ Stadium, like them to do it again here. Their last 3 wins over them have been by 14 points or more against them, and like the momentum that they are starting to put together. Expect them to have too much here as they have plenty to play for while the Bulldogs are resigned to missing out once again. Dragons -19.5 @ 2.85 centrebet Dragons are pretty ruthless in that they give little away and apply constant pressure before the opposition cracks and they take advaantage of the mistakes they make. The Titans make more missed tackles than any other side and that should see the Dragons make quite a few busts to set up tries for their wide players like Gasnier, Cooper and Morris. The Dragons have won 6 of the last 7 meetings and they tend to keep the Titans from scoring double figures, so can see them scoring quite a few tries while the Titans will find it hard to beat a team that has the lowest number of missed tackles. The Titans tend to struggle on the road and with the Dragons at Kogarah on a cold Friday night, like them to win this one quite comfortably as they have too much size and power in the forwards while the backs are far too talented. Campbell and Prince are very good but outside them, the rest are solid, yet their is class throughout the Dragons backline.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...

Crouch Potato Posted July 24, 2010 Share Posted July 24, 2010 Re: NRL Round 20 Sharks @ 3.55 Betfair Sharks have a new coach this week and this should give the players added motivation to impress. Four of the last six teams with new coaches have won first up. Furthermore, the Sharks have won their last 5 games against a Raiders side who are terrible inconsistent. Last week they scored 50, an achievement which in recent times has been followed up with a loss. They rarely win 3 in a row and coupled with the match up advantage and new coach factor that the Sharks have going I see big value in this.
